Understanding Bayes' Theorem

Bayes' Theorem is a fundamental concept in probability theory and statistics that describes how to update the probability of a hypothesis based on new evidence. It's widely used in various fields, from medical diagnosis to machine learning.

  • Prior Probability (P(H)): Your initial belief in the hypothesis before observing any evidence.
  • Likelihood (P(E|H)): The probability of observing the evidence if the hypothesis is true.
  • Evidence Probability (P(E)): The overall probability of observing the evidence.
  • Posterior Probability (P(H|E)): Your updated belief in the hypothesis after considering the evidence. This is what Bayes' Theorem calculates.

In essence, Bayes' Theorem allows us to refine our understanding of the likelihood of an event by incorporating new data. It's a powerful tool for making informed decisions under uncertainty.
